“For Syria… Damascus”, an exhibition for students of architecture faculty opens at Damascus University
Damascus (ST): Under the auspices of Vice President Dr. Najah al-Attar, the faculty of architecture, Damascus University organized an exhibition under the title ” For Syria.. Damascus”.
The exhibits includes projects for 200 students about the historical buildings and sites in Old Damascus.
The one-week exhibition, currently on display at Reda Sa’ed Hall for Conferences, aims at preserving the spiritual and social environment of Old Damascus.
The supervisor of the exhibition, Dr. Abeer Arqawimade a speech in which she affirmed the necessity of putting forward a national work plan with the participation of all ministries and concerned authorities to preserve Old Damascus and protect its historical buildings.
The Minister of Higher Education and Scientific Research, Dr. Bassam Ibrahim, who represented Dr. al-Attar in the opening of the event, expressed high appreciation for the efforts exerted by the students and teachers of the faculty of architecture to make the event a success.
In turn, Damascus University Rector Dr. Mohammad Maher Qabaqibi said that the event represents a real embodiment of the slogan: “Linking the University with Society”.
Dean of the Faculty of Architectural Engineering Dr. Okba Fakoush said that the event casts light the projects being carried out in Old Damascus and the necessity of preserving its time-old heritage.
